在当今信息化时代,数据和信息的自由流动至关重要,无论是开发测试、远程办公,还是个人文件的存取,打破网络限制、实现内网穿透都是关键需求,而Natapp作为一款功能强大的内网穿透工具,正逐渐成为解决这些问题的首选方案,本文将详细介绍Natapp的功能、使用步骤以及其与CDN的结合优势,帮助读者更好地理解和应用这款工具。
内网穿透(NAT穿透)是指通过某种方式打破NAT(网络地址转换)设备的限制,实现内外网之间的直接通信,简而言之,就是让内网中的设备能够被外网访问,常见的内网穿透工具有frp、ngrok、zerotier等,每种工具都有其特点和适用场景,但今天要介绍的Natapp凭借其简单易用和强大功能,赢得了许多用户的青睐。
Natapp是一款基于Web的内网穿透工具,支持多个平台,包括Windows、Mac、Linux等,它可以帮助用户快速、安全地将内网服务暴露到公网上,从而实现远程访问和控制,无论您是开发人员、系统管理员,还是普通用户,只需几步操作,就能轻松实现内网穿透。
1、多协议支持:Natapp支持HTTP、HTTPS、TCP、UDP等多种协议,满足不同应用场景的需求。
2、高稳定性:通过优化的网络传输算法,保证连接的稳定性和速度,即使在复杂的网络环境下也能保持高效传输。
3、安全性:采用加密传输,确保数据在传输过程中的安全性,防止中间人攻击和数据泄露。
4、易用性:友好的用户界面和详细的文档,让用户即学即用,无需复杂的配置即可上手。
5、灵活性:支持多种隧道配置,可根据实际需求进行灵活调整,满足个性化的使用场景。
为了更好地提升访问速度和用户体验,Natapp可以与CDN(内容分发网络)结合使用,CDN通过将内容缓存到离用户最近的服务器上,可以显著提高访问速度和响应时间,以下是Natapp与CDN结合的优势:
1、加速访问:通过CDN的全球节点分布,用户可以更快地访问内网资源,减少延迟和卡顿现象。
2、减轻服务器负担:CDN缓存静态资源,减少对原服务器的请求压力,从而提高服务器的性能和稳定性。
3、提高可用性:即使原服务器出现故障,CDN节点上的缓存内容仍然可以继续提供服务,确保业务的连续性。
4、安全防护:CDN提供DDoS防护、WAF(Web应用防火墙)等安全措施,增强内网服务的安全性。
搭建Natapp与CDN需要几个简单的步骤:
1、注册并登录Natapp:访问Natapp官网,完成注册并登录。
2、创建隧道:根据需要创建内网穿透隧道,填写相应的端口和协议信息。
3、获取CDN服务:选择一个可靠的CDN服务提供商,如阿里云CDN、腾讯云CDN等,注册并配置CDN服务。
4、配置CDN:将Natapp生成的域名解析到CDN服务的IP地址,并配置缓存规则和安全策略。
5、测试访问:完成配置后,通过访问CDN的加速域名,验证内网穿透是否成功,并检查访问速度和稳定性。
下面以Linux系统为例,详细介绍如何使用Natapp实现内网穿透。
1. 安装Natapp客户端
需要在Linux服务器上安装Natapp客户端,连接到服务器后,执行以下命令下载并安装Natapp:
进入/usr/local目录 cd /usr/local 创建natapp文件夹 mkdir natapp 进入natapp目录 cd natapp 下载Natapp客户端 wget -O natapp https://cdn.natapp.cn/assets/downloads/clients/2_3_9/natapp_linux_amd64/natapp?version=20190730 给Natapp添加执行权限 chmod u+x natapp
2. 获取authtoken
注册并登录Natapp官网,购买免费隧道后,在“我的隧道”页面找到对应的authtoken并复制。
3. 运行Natapp客户端
在natapp目录下运行以下命令启动Natapp客户端:
运行Natapp客户端并指定authtoken ./natapp -authtoken=你的authtoken
启动成功后,会显示类似如下的信息:
Tunnel Status online Version 当前客户端版本 Forwarding http://随机域名 -> 127.0.0.1:8080
其中http://随机域名
即为Natapp分配的公网访问地址,可以在外网通过该地址访问内网服务。
4. 后台运行Natapp客户端
为了在关闭终端后继续运行Natapp客户端,可以使用nohup命令将其放入后台运行:
nohup ./natapp -authtoken=你的authtoken &
5. 验证内网穿透
在内网服务器上部署一个测试服务,例如一个简单的web应用,然后在外网浏览器中输入Natapp分配的域名,验证是否能够正常访问内网服务,如果一切正常,说明内网穿透已经成功配置。
除了基本的配置外,Natapp还提供了一些高级配置选项,帮助用户进一步优化内网穿透的性能和安全性。
1. 修改配置文件
用户可以通过修改config.ini文件,自定义Natapp的参数。
[default] authtoken = 你的authtoken log = none loglevel = ERROR http_proxy = http://10.123.10.10:3128
保存为config.ini文件,并放置在natapp同级目录下,然后通过以下命令启动Natapp:
./natapp -config=config.ini
2. 多隧道配置
如果需要同时开启多个隧道,可以创建多个config.ini文件,或者在命令行中指定不同的配置文件。
nohup ./natapp -config=config1.ini & nohup ./natapp -config=config2.ini &
3. 安全设置
为了增强安全性,建议启用日志记录和调整日志等级:
log = ./natapp.log loglevel = INFO
定期检查日志文件,及时发现和处理异常情况。
Natapp作为一款功能强大的内网穿透工具,不仅操作简单,而且性能稳定,能够满足大多数用户的内网穿透需求,通过与CDN结合,还能进一步提升访问速度和用户体验,无论是个人用户还是企业用户,都可以轻松上手,享受自由、高效的网络体验,希望本文的介绍能够帮助大家更好地了解和应用Natapp,实现内网资源的便捷访问和高效利用。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态